Gekko Technology to introduce kelvin TILE
LED soft lighting panel at IBC 2009
July 14, 2009
Source: Gekko Technology
Gekko Technology's new
kelvin TILE, scheduled for introduction at IBC 2009 in September,
is an LED-based lighting system employing a combination of
red, green, blue, cyan, amber and white LED elements in a
16 x 15 matrix to generate high-quality full-spectrum white
light specifically for film and video production. Unlike traditional
luminaires, the colour temperature of kelvin TILE remains
consistent throughout the full range of intensity variation.

"The kelvin TILE is a compact soft light giving directors
or cameramen total control over colour temperature from 2,200
to 6,500 Kelvin with resets at 3,000 and 5,500 K," explains
Gekko Technology founder and Managing Director David Amphlett.
"It is a soft-light companion to the focusable Gekko
kedo which we showed in prototype at the NAB 2009 convention.
Being LED-based, it is highly robust, has a long working life
and will not cook the performers. It is designed for general
soft-light applications including concealment of wrinkles
and shadows."
Measuring 301 x 301 x 99 mm (WHD), each kelvin TILE delivers
up to 419 Lux at 5,500 K or 273 Lux at 3,000 K (both measured
at 1 metre distance) with a power consumption of only 85 W.
Beam angle is 108 degrees at 50 per cent intensity. The kelvin
TILE can be supplied with an omni mount, single or double
yoke mount, removable barndoors and kelvin PAINTBOX control
software. Weight is 4.08 kg.
The kelvin TILE can be controlled locally, via DMX or using
the kelvin PAINTBOX. In addition to complete calibrated control
of white light, the kelvin PAINTBOX provides independent control
of up to eight individual tiles, allowing lighting parameters
to be saved, recalled and cloned. In RGB mode, the kelvin
PAINTBOX provides access to a wide palette of colour lighting
effects included washes, sweeps and strobes, as well as adjustable
green biasing. Lighting parameters can be saved, recalled
and cloned.

Gekko Technology designs and manufactures LED lighting products
for the global film, television and photographic industry.
Gekko is committed to supporting users with innovative products,
including unique functionality and the advantages of minimal
weight, low power consumption and long life.
High component quality and build quality are key drivers.
Gekko Technology products include kisslite, lenslite,
kicklite and george (TM). Credits include Casino Royale,
Quantum of Solace, Death Defying Acts, Mama Mia, Golden Compass
and television drama such as Star Trek, Desperate Housewives,
Waking the Dead, New Tricks and The Commander.
